Each customer’s box can be expanded to show the health status for each disk:Ĭustomers can see their cumulative disk health statistics. The color of each block corresponds to the current average state of the disks installed in the computers of a specific customer. This monitoring does not slow down the user machine in any way, as Acronis agents are optimized to act during disk operations that happen during software running cycles.Īs a result, the admins at a service provider will be able to see something like this: Disks are actively monitored for latency distribution, giving the AI more data to process. There are also several events in the Windows operating system related to HDD and SSD performance that are analyzed as well, including bad blocks reported, delays or no access to disk, delayed write to disk, file systems corruption, etc.Īcronis software agents also collect the write/read performance on endpoint machines, so both the transfer rate and disk queue length is taken into consideration when creating the ML model. reports of the disk drive itself, with many parameters collected and analyzed at scheduled time intervals. The main source of data actually comes from the S.M.A.R.T. Using machine learning, it processes a large amount of disk-drive-related parameters to build a model that can predict when a drive will fail with a high degree of accuracy. The ultimate goal was to decrease the downtime caused by storage media failure by providing users with an easy, automated way to both predict the failure and quickly recover from it.Īcronis achieved this goal by developing Acronis Disk Health Service, which predicts disk drive failure and alerts the administrator, suggesting various actions to decrease expected downtime.Īcronis Disk Health Service is a cloud-based service that is hosted in the company’s data centers around the world. Many of our developments are focused on data safety predictions and, as a result, using disk drives as storage media were of interest to our engineers. Predicting drive failure using artificial intelligenceĪs an innovative technology company, Acronis has been investing in various art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) based technologies for several years. Microsoft protects all its files with an Advanced Encryption Standard and a cryptographic hash function so your password can be converted into a 128-bit key. You can keep the contents of your file private with a password so only authorized can view it. This means it limits the capabilities it can execute thus reducing the risk of a macro-based virus from entering your PC.Īnother feature you can use is the Password Protect. Word 2019 has a solution for this it regulates the macros functions of a file. These are used to prevent repetitive sequences of automated keystrokes and mouse movements however, it can also host viruses from emails, instant messaging applications, and USB flash drives. Securityįiles created in Microsoft 365 can be embedded with programs and advanced macros. This feature will help those that express themselves better through speech. You can dictate words, punctuation marks, new lines, and new paragraphs. Once a red dot appears on the page, it means that the Dictate feature is active. Its similar to the Windows Speech Recognition (or Speech Services) feature except that the activity is under Word’s control. There is also an option for you to dictate the words you want to appear on the paper. There is also a catalog of different voices that have a variety of accents. You can instruct it to fast forward, go back, pause, read louder, faster, etc. It appears as a small toolbar on the upper right corner of the text area. As the name suggests, the tool reads the text on the page for you. Read Aloud is an updated version of a previous Office Command - Speak. It’s a set of five tools, namely Column Width, Page Color, Text Spacing, Syllables, and Read Aloud. Learning Tools is Word’s collection of tools that will help with reading comprehension.
